Our Waltham crew responds within 60 to 90 minutes and conducts a sensitive, thorough assessment. We evaluate the extent of biological contamination, identify all affected materials, and create a detailed cleanup plan.
We remove all decomposition fluids, biological materials, and contaminated building components. Affected carpet, padding, subfloor, drywall, and insulation are removed and disposed of through certified biohazard facilities.
All Trauma Scene Cleanup uses a multi-step decontamination and odor elimination process at your Waltham, MA property. Hospital-grade disinfectants, enzyme treatments, and industrial odor technology ensure the space is safe and odor-free.
Our Waltham crew rebuilds everything that was removed — subfloor, drywall, insulation, flooring, paint, and trim. We restore the property completely and work with your insurance company throughout.

Unattended death cleanup in Waltham typically ranges from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the stage of decomposition, affected area, materials requiring removal, and odor severity. Advanced decomposition with structural penetration costs more due to extensive material removal. All Trauma Scene Cleanup provides free assessments with detailed estimates.
Many homeowner and landlord insurance policies cover unattended death cleanup in Waltham as part of property damage claims. Coverage varies by policy. Extended unattended deaths require more extensive cleanup including removal of flooring, subfloor, drywall, and sometimes framing. Decomposition fluids penetrate deeply over time. The property owner or their representative is typically responsible for cleanup after an unattended death in Waltham. For rental properties, the landlord bears responsibility.
